Home Sweet Home
With five home games in the Club’s first six matches, City will be aiming to hit the ground running in season 2021/22.
City fans will be able to enjoy a bonus home game in the early rounds of the season as we host Western Sydney Wanderers on Wednesday 22 December at AAMI Park in a clash that has been brought forward from later in the season.
Melbourne Derby Magic
Two of the three Melbourne Derby fixtures will be City home games this season with the first marking the return of the ‘Christmas Derby’. AAMI Park will undoubtedly be rocking in City blue on Saturday 18 December and again on Saturday 12 March, 2022.
Our away Derby at AAMI Park is set for the final round of the regular season in what will be a bumper finish ahead of the 2022 finals series.
Finals Fever
The 2022 Finals Series is set for a different feel this season, with a new schedule set to provide more action than ever before! The Finals Series will now be played over four weeks, with home and away legs now set to have fans on the edge across two weekends of semi-final action.
